Understanding the Role of CNC Machining in Woodworking

CNC machining has transformed traditional woodworking practices by introducing automation and precision into the craft. As you may know, CNC machines operate based on computer-generated designs, allowing for intricate cuts and shapes that would be nearly impossible to achieve manually. This technology not only enhances the quality of your work but also increases production speed, making it an invaluable tool in modern woodworking.

The role of CNC machining extends beyond mere efficiency; it also opens up new avenues for creativity. With CNC technology, you can experiment with complex designs and patterns that push the boundaries of traditional woodworking. This capability allows you to create unique pieces that stand out in a competitive market.

As you embrace CNC machining in your woodworking endeavors, you will find that it empowers you to bring your most ambitious ideas to life.

Integrating Woodworks Software with CNC Machines

Photo Woodworks Software

Integrating Woodworks software with your CNC machines is a critical step in maximizing its potential benefits. Most modern CNC machines are designed to work seamlessly with various software applications, allowing for smooth communication between design and production. As you set up this integration, ensure that your machine’s firmware is up-to-date and compatible with the latest version of Woodworks software.

Once integrated, you’ll find that transferring designs from the software to your CNC machine is a straightforward process. The software typically generates G-code or other machine-readable formats that your CNC machine can interpret directly. This seamless transition not only saves time but also reduces the risk of errors during data transfer, ensuring that your designs are executed as intended.

What is Woodworks Software for CNC Machining?

Woodworks software for CNC machining is a specialized computer program designed to assist in the design and production of wood products using C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machines. It helps in creating precise and intricate designs for woodwork projects.

What are the features of Woodworks Software for CNC Machining?

Woodworks software for CNC machining typically includes features such as 3D modeling, toolpath generation, nesting, material optimization, and simulation. It allows users to visualize their designs in 3D, generate toolpaths for CNC machines, and optimize material usage for cost-effective production.

How does Woodworks Software for CNC Machining benefit woodworkers?

Woodworks software for CNC machining streamlines the design and production process, reduces material waste, and improves accuracy and efficiency. It also enables woodworkers to create complex and intricate designs that would be difficult to achieve manually.

What types of wood products can be created using Woodworks Software for CNC Machining?

Woodworks software for CNC machining can be used to create a wide range of wood products, including furniture, cabinetry, decorative panels, moldings, and architectural components. It is suitable for both functional and decorative woodwork projects.
